[Shrinking lung syndrome and systemic auto-immune disease]

Summary
Shrinking lung syndrome, a rare condition causing shortness of breath and reduced lung volume, is linked to autoimmune diseases. Its exact cause and optimal treatment remain uncertain, requiring careful consideration in affected patients.

Background:
- Shrinking lung syndrome presents with dyspnea and decreased lung volumes, often associated with elevated diaphragm.
- The syndrome is frequently linked to systemic autoimmune diseases, though its physiopathological mechanisms are debated.
Observation:
- Three cases of shrinking lung syndrome are presented, with two diagnosed concurrently with autoimmune disease onset.
- Patients were treated with corticosteroids, and two also received theophylline.
- A literature review identified 60 cases, aiding discussion on uncertain physiopathological mechanisms.
Findings:
- Diaphragmatic dysfunction, potentially due to myositis or neuropathy, is a key area of investigation.
- Abnormal transdiaphragmatic pressures are discussed as indicators of diaphragmatic dysfunction.
- The clinical, pathological, and functional features of shrinking lung syndrome are often controversial, complicating diagnosis.
Implications:
- Shrinking lung syndrome is rare but critical to consider in autoimmune patients experiencing dyspnea.
- Diagnostic challenges arise from the controversial features of the syndrome.
- The optimal treatment strategy for shrinking lung syndrome is currently unknown.
